
Collaboration covers key countries across the GCC and the Levant
UnionPay International (UPI) and Amazon Payment Services have announced a strategic collaboration in the Middle East and North Africa (MENA) region, across countries including UAE, Saudi Arabia, Qatar, Bahrain, Kuwait, Egypt, Jordan, and Lebanon.
Luping Zhang, General Manager, UnionPay International Middle East and Pablo Londono, Managing Director, Amazon Payment Services, signed the agreement in the presence of senior officials from both organizations.
“This partnership aligns with our commitment to providing seamless payment solutions and supporting the growth of digital commerce across the region. By working with Amazon Payment Services, we are enabling more businesses to cater to the growing base of UnionPay cardholders,” noted Zhang.
Frictionless transactions
“Integrating UnionPay into the Amazon Payment Services merchant network further strengthens our ability to serve international shoppers and facilitate secure, frictionless transactions for businesses across multiple countries,” commented Londono.
The agreement empowers merchants in the Amazon Payment Services network to accept UnionPay cards, creating secure, convenient and seamless transactions. Once the integration is complete, millions of UnionPay cardholders will be able to access a frictionless payment experience with Amazon Payment Services’ merchants.
